Q goal is to create effectively omniscient artificial intelligence, what am I doing? Because Eventually, isn't the sort of God models from OpenAI, from Anthropic, just going to subsume and do what I'm trying to do anyway? Why would I be building? I mean, what do you think about this? Is there, is there some conflict there? Do you think that these model builders will eventually just subsume all AI startups?
A There's certainly a risk that the model builders will Can, uh, dominate the industries, particular industries that, that their models are most effective if that's their goal. There's a great risk. And also those model builders are spending tens of, or hundreds of millions of dollars per training and exercise and, and in order to get to the point where these models are effective in solving these problems. So you can imagine a world where the five or so companies in the world can kind of dominate everything. That's one dystopian world. Then there's another world, more like Sifu was talking about, where there's Uh, there's an infrastructure that's been created and from that infrastructure, many companies will dominate vertical areas. Why will they dominate verticals in, in, in particular industries? Because they're going to have the data and the expertise and the focus on specific consumer segments that are going to be most effective at reaching those consumer segments. So from my point of view, I believe that these big companies will never try to focus sufficiently on the market verticals that will really make a huge difference to that particular market, and so the industry will flourish in each of these individual markets.
